자바스크립트란?
컴퓨터 함수의 역할
컴퓨터 함수를 사용하여 코드를 구조화하면 유지보수가 쉬워지고 버그를 줄일 수 있습니다. 또한, 함수를 통해 코드의 일부를 재사용할 수 있기 때문에 효율적인 프로그래밍이 가능합니다. 함수를 잘 활용하면 코드의 복잡성을 줄이고 프로그램을 보다 효율적으로 작성할 수 있습니다.
컴퓨터 함수는 프로그래밍 언어마다 문법이 다를 수 있지만, 기본적인 개념은 어떤 작업을 수행하는 코드의 묶음이라는 점에서 동일합니다. 프로그래머는 함수를 설계하고 활용함으로써 보다 효율적이고 가독성 있는 코드를 작성할 수 있습니다. 함수를 적재적으로 활용하여 프로그램을 작성하는 것은 프로그래머에게 중요한 역할을 합니다.
함수 구현을 위한 기본 개념
첫째로, 함수는 입력을 받아 결과를 반환합니다. 이를 위해 매개변수(parameter)를 정의하고 반환문(return statement)을 활용하여 결과를 반환할 수 있습니다. 매개변수를 활용하여 함수에 입력값을 전달할 수 있습니다.
둘째로, 함수는 재사용이 가능합니다. 한 번 작성한 함수는 프로그램 어디서든 호출하여 사용할 수 있습니다. 이는 코드의 중복을 피하고 유지보수성을 높이는 데 도움이 됩니다.
또한, 함수는 모듈화(Modularization)에 도움을 줍니다. 프로그램을 작은 단위로 쪼개어 함수로 구성하면 각 함수가 각각의 역할을 수행하게 되어 코드를 더욱 효율적으로 관리할 수 있습니다.
이와 같은 기본 개념을 숙지하고 함수를 적절히 구현한다면 프로그래밍 작업을 보다 효율적으로 수행할 수 있을 것입니다. 함수는 프로그래밍 언어에서 핵심적인 요소이므로 기본적인 이해와 활용이 중요합니다.
자바스크립트를 활용한 함수 구현 예시
“`javascript
// 두 수를 더하는 함수
function addNumbers(num1, num2) {
return num1 + num2;
}
// 함수 호출
const sum = addNumbers(5, 3);
console.log(sum); // 결과: 8
“`
위의 예시에서 `addNumbers` 함수는 두 개의 숫자를 매개변수로 받아 더한 후 반환합니다. 이렇게 함수를 사용하면 필요할 때마다 재사용할 수 있어 효율적입니다. 또한 함수는 변수에 할당하여 호출할 수 있어 코드를 더 깔끔하게 만들어 줍니다.
자바스크립트를 활용한 함수 구현은 프로그래밍의 핵심이므로, 코드를 더욱 효과적으로 작성하고 유지보수하기 쉽게 만들어줍니다. 함수를 잘 활용하여 웹 개발 프로젝트를 진행하면 보다 효율적이고 실용적인 코드를 작성할 수 있습니다.